Dantra Population - Rajsamand, Rajasthan

Dantra is a medium size village located in Deogarh Tehsil of Rajsamand district, Rajasthan with total 148 families residing. The Dantra village has population of 674 of which 355 are males while 319 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Dantra village population of children with age 0-6 is 141 which makes up 20.92 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Dantra village is 899 which is lower than Rajasthan state average of 928. Child Sex Ratio for the Dantra as per census is 763, lower than Rajasthan average of 888.

Dantra village has lower literacy rate compared to Rajasthan. In 2011, literacy rate of Dantra village was 59.29 % compared to 66.11 % of Rajasthan. In Dantra Male literacy stands at 65.45 % while female literacy rate was 52.71 %.

Caste Factor

In Dantra village, most of the village population is from Schedule Tribe (ST).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 44.81 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 4.01 % of total population in Dantra village.

Work Profile

In Dantra village out of total population, 298 were engaged in work activities. 65.10 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 34.90 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 298 workers engaged in Main Work, 116 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 1 were Agricultural labourer.
